Why did charles darwin become a biologist?

Naturalist Charles Darwin<span> was born in Shrewsbury, England, on February 12, 1809. In 1831, he embarked on a five-year survey voyage around the world on the HMS Beagle. His studies of specimens around the globe led him to formulate his theory of evolution and his views on the process of natural selection.</span>

A blue-eyed, left-handed woman marries a brown-eyed, right-handed man who is heterozygous for both of his traits. if blue eyes a
Pavel [41]
4 different phenotypes may be produced. If you write this down in a Punnet square you can get the exact ratio and the genotypes along with the phenotypes. 

Let us assign B for brown eyes, b for blue eyes; H for right-handed, h for left-handed. 
The mother's genotype will then be bbhh
The father's genotype will then be BbHh

           bh        bh         bh           bh
BH    BbHh    BbHh    BbHh      BbHh  
Bh     Bbhh    Bbhh     Bbhh      Bbhh
bH     bbHh   bbHh     bbHh      bbHh
bh      bbhh    bbhh     bbhh       bbhh

Now based on that you can see that there are 4 possible genotypic combinations which would express different phenotypic combinations as well. 

BbHh: Brown-eyed, right-handed
Bbhh: Brown-eyed, left-handed
bbHh:  Blue-eyed, right handed
bbhh:   Blue-eyed, left-handed

So again, there would be 4 possible phenotypes.

On which bone does Jugular Foramen occurs?
balandron [24]

Answer:

The petrous temporal bone

Explanation:

Jugular Foramen is a cavity or aperture which is formed at the junction of two bones of the skull. Jugular Foramen occurs at the junction of the occipital bone and petrous temporal bone. The petrous temporal bone has carotid foramen. The Jugular Foramen is located posterior to the carotid foramen but anterior to the occipital bone of the skull.
